These are a couple of profiles of North American P-51D-30-NA Mustang serial 44-74506, which flew in the 1960s Reno air races in a variety of different colours and forms as N335J, operated by Ed Weiner. I made a set of these for the 97th issue of Warbird Digest magazine. Attached are profiles of N335J as she looked in 1964, and in 1967, when she was being optimised for air racing, complete with cropped wings and tail plane and taped off(!) panel lines - plus a funky zebra colour scheme.
